Donation from Stop Exploitation Now

For the past two year Stop Exploitation Now has been kindly sending donations to the Riverkids Foundation. Stop Exploitation Now is an American NGO that was set up in 2005 and has its headquarters in Seattle, Washington. This NGO focuses its donations mainly in the Southeast Asia region.

Recently Stop Exploitation Now has donated important items such as books, crayons, coloring markers, pens, pencils and soccer balls to the foundation. They have furthermore donated another $40 to buy more books. In addition to this the sponsor has gifted $125 which will be used to pay for water, snacks and uniforms for the children who attend soccer training every Saturday in Phnom Penh. This is a real help because without it some of the children could not attend. The contribution of the teaching aids and books will help a lot because before this there was a shortage of such necessary materials. Following the donation of the books more children are able to have the opportunity to improve their reading skills. Arts and crafts are also taught to some of the children. The markers, pens, pencils and crayons will be of a great benefit to the students here where supplies were short. The kids also like to play games but there was not enough equipment for all of the children. The games help the children to relax and burn off energy between classes and so the extra footballs will be of a great benefit to them.

Most of these children before they started with Riverkids had little or no schooling. What little schooling they had was poor and unvaried. At Riverkids however the children have a wide range of activities such as English, Arts & Crafts and Computers. These help to stimulate their minds and help them to grow both physically and mentally. Learning new things give the children enormous self confidence which can only be good for their future.
